The Transbay Fest is an innovative modular event series that celebrates film, transmedia, video, apps, games and augmented reality and acts as a catalyst for conversation, exploration, and engagement.
Free for the first 100 RSVPs, there’s a $5-$20 donation after that, and an RSVP is required.
The Transbay Fest Wrap Party features two performance sessions at Dimension 7 Studios in San Francisco, from 6:30-8:30 pm and 9:30-11:30 pm on Saturday, October 12, 2013.
Transbay Fest 2013 Wrap Party
Saturday, October 12, 2013 | 6:30-11:30 pm
Dimension 7 Studios, 150 Folsom St , San Francisco
FREEAct 1: Session 1
“Cypherpunks Part II: Fight” w/Andy Isaacson: a co-founder of Noisebridge, and runs their Tor exit node.“Texting Sea Turtles and Cars Making Music” w/Tom Zimmerman: an inventor, educator and researcher at IBM Research-Almaden exploring the boundaries of human/creature/machine interface. His inventions include the DataGlove (controller for Virtual Reality), Personal Area Network (sending data through the body), Lensless Stereo Microscope+more.
“New Human Interfaces for Music” w/Matt Moldover: a composer/producer/performer & product specialist for Native Instruments Inc./has worked with artists like Sarah Fimm, Jennifer Matthews, Kelly Buchanan, and The Emphatics, and designed a customized control interface for Bassnectar with 60-Works Controllers.
Act 2: Intermission
Act 3: Session 2
“Digital Fabrication and Interactive 3D: A Better Way To Build” w/Damon Hernandez: actively involved with the 3D web convergence with technologies including GIS, CAD/BIM/CAM, AR & mobile/has built numerous mixed reality applications & has lead dozens of research projects & worked with several 3D web and virtual world companies and is currently with IDEAbuilder.“Aerial Imaging and Drones: A Different Perspective” w/ Eric Cheng: the founder and publisher of Wetpixel.com, the premiere community website for underwater image makers.
“Analog Modular Video Synthesis” w/ Jordan Gray aka Starpause the k9d: is Manager of Creative Labs @OrganicInc and co-founder of CODAME, a SF based event celebrating the intersection of ART+TECH.
Sound reactive generative visuals by Karen Marcelo (Founder of DorkbotSF)
